CourseDetails
โข Oil Spill Response Planning: Developing comprehensive plans to respond to oil spills, including emergency preparedness, response strategies, and post-spill assessment.
โข Ecological Assessment: Evaluating the environmental impact of oil spills, identifying vulnerable ecosystems, and monitoring recovery progress.
โข Oil Spill Cleanup Techniques: Exploring various methods for oil spill cleanup, such as mechanical recovery, bioremediation, and chemical dispersants.
โข Wildlife Rescue and Rehabilitation: Techniques and strategies for rescuing and rehabilitating affected wildlife, including oiled bird care and marine mammal rescue.
โข Regulations and Compliance: Understanding local, national, and international regulations for oil spill prevention, response, and reclamation.
โข Oil Spill Prevention: Implementing best practices to prevent oil spills, including risk assessment, equipment maintenance, and staff training.
โข Community Engagement: Strategies for engaging local communities in oil spill response and reclamation efforts, ensuring transparency and collaboration.
โข Technological Innovations: Investigating advanced technologies for oil spill detection, response, and reclamation, including remote sensing and drones.
โข Environmental Restoration: Techniques for restoring impacted ecosystems, including habitat creation, native species planting, and sediment remediation.
โข Case Studies: Analyzing real-world oil spill incidents and their reclamation efforts, examining successes, failures, and lessons learned.
